House of Commons Library

The House of Commons Library has published a very useful summary of the current state of play for gaining and losing parental responsibility.

Their website explains that the summary considers the meaning of parental responsibility, and the fact that it is not a constant right, but diminishes as the child gets older and so can reach a sufficient understanding and intelligence of the consequences of decisions relating to them.

How parental responsibility can be acquired and lost can depend on the person concerned and certain court orders. There can be restrictions on how parental responsibility is exercised, including the gaining of court orders in order to settle or prohibit a particular action by someone with parental responsibility.

Briefing Paper

The Briefing Paper is called ‘Children: Parental Responsibility – What is it and How is it Gained or Lost. The full note is here.

The note applies to England and Wales only.
